If you want to live a healthy lifestyle, one important part of that is learning how to eat a nutritious diet. Nutrition affects how you feel, and combined with physical activity you will be well on your way to a healthy body.
Should fast-food be a staple in your diet, then it’s time to restrict how much of it you can eat. Unhealthy foods, such as processed foods, are low in nutrients and high in calories. Unfortunately, their wide availability and convenience has led to an obesity epidemic in the United States.
On top of increased weight gain, an unhealthy diet can result in major health risks that can lead to diseases or even death. Without proper nutrition, one is at risk of developing heart disease, type-2 diabetes, high blood pressure, and cancer.
There is a connection between good nutrition, reduced risk of disease, and a healthy weight. If you value your life, you should be taking steps to ensure you eat a diet that includes lots of vegetables, fiber, whole grains, and fruits.
